Fix for Video Tearing on Intel driver???

Alwin Bakkenes alwin at bakkenes.nu
Mon Oct 1 10:37:40 PDT 2007


Ironically enough. I so much want to see my HTPC work with solid video;
unfortunately

 

Using the XV Textured Video port, I get video tearing and using the XV
Overlay port I get XServer resets.

 

If I play a movie using mplayer -vo xv:port=89 and try to play another movie
after that, the XServer resets (or shows a completely blue screen) and shows
the following error log; 

 

WW) intel(0): xf86UnbindGARTMemory: unbinding of gart memory with key
-526862 failed (Invalid argument)

 

Backtrace:

0: /usr/bin/X(xf86SigHandler+0x6d) [0x490d9d]

1: /lib64/libc.so.6 [0x3a95e30bd0]

2: /usr/lib64/xorg/modules/drivers//intel_drv.so(i830_free_memory+0x30)
[0x2aaaabc4ee80]

3: /usr/lib64/xorg/modules/drivers//intel_drv.so [0x2aaaabc54117]

4: /usr/bin/X [0x4813fa]

5: /usr/lib64/xorg/modules/extensions//libextmod.so [0x2aaaaad9aebd]

6: /usr/bin/X(Dispatch+0x1db) [0x44bb2b]

7: /usr/bin/X(main+0x45d) [0x43489d]

8: /lib64/libc.so.6(__libc_start_main+0xf4) [0x3a95e1dff4]

9: /usr/bin/X(FontFileCompleteXLFD+0x261) [0x433b69]

 

Fatal server error:

Caught signal 11.  Server aborting

 

(II) AIGLX: Suspending AIGLX clients for VT switch

Error in I830WaitLpRing(), timeout for 2 seconds

pgetbl_ctl: 0x1 pgetbl_err: 0x10000

ipeir: 0 iphdr: 0

LP ring tail: 7a0 head: 0 len: 0 start 0

eir: 0 esr: 10 emr: ffff

instdone: ffc0 instpm: 0

memmode: 306 instps: 7800

hwstam: ffff ier: 2 imr: ffff iir: 0

Ring at virtual 0xace53000 head 0x0 tail 0x7a0 count 488

           0001ff80: 02000011

           0001ff84: 00000000

           0001ff88: 02000011

           0001ff8c: 00000000

           0001ff90: 02000011

           0001ff94: 00000000

           0001ff98: 02000011

           0001ff9c: 00000000

           0001ffa0: 02000011

           0001ffa4: 00000000

           0001ffa8: 02000011

           0001ffac: 00000000

           0001ffb0: 02000011

           0001ffb4: 00000000

           0001ffb8: 02000011

           0001ffbc: 00000000

           0001ffc0: 02000011

           0001ffc4: 00000000

           0001ffc8: 02000011

           0001ffcc: 00000000

           0001ffd0: 02000011

           0001ffd4: 00000000

           0001ffd8: 02000011

           0001ffdc: 00000000

           0001ffe0: 02000011

           0001ffe4: 00000000

           0001ffe8: 02000011

           0001ffec: 00000000

           0001fff0: 02000011

           0001fff4: 00000000

           0001fff8: 02000011

           0001fffc: 00000000

           00000000: 02000011

Ring end

space: 129112 wanted 131064

(II) intel(0): [drm] removed 1 reserved context for kernel

(II) intel(0): [drm] unmapping 8192 bytes of SAREA 0x2efff000 at
0x2aaaac8bd000

(II) intel(0): [drm] Closed DRM master.

 

FatalError re-entered, aborting

lockup

 

-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.x.org/archives/xorg/attachments/20071001/3663fe50/attachment.html>


More information about the xorg mailing list